Most small businesses manage projects through email threads, shared spreadsheets, and WhatsApp groups. This approach works until it suddenly does not — when a deadline is missed because an email was buried, when two team members are working on the same task because no one assigned ownership, or when a client asks for a project update and no one has a clear answer.
Project management software solves these problems by centralising every task, deadline, and communication in one visible place. Project management software is more effective when paired with the right methodology for your team’s work. Understanding the three most common approaches helps you configure your chosen tool correctly from day one.
Kanban visualises work as cards on a board, moving through columns representing stages (To Do ? In Progress ? Review ? Done). It has no fixed time periods — work flows through continuously. Best for: support teams, marketing content pipelines, product feature requests, and any work without fixed deadlines. Best tool for Kanban: Trello. Secondary: Monday.com and ClickUp both have excellent Kanban views.
Scrum organises work into fixed-duration sprints (1–4 weeks), with a backlog of tasks prioritised before each sprint. Daily standups, sprint reviews, and retrospectives create a rhythm of continuous improvement. Best for: software development teams, product teams, and any work that benefits from iterative delivery and feedback. Best tool for Scrum: ClickUp (native sprint management, GitHub integration). Secondary: Jira (Atlassian’s dedicated Scrum tool).
Waterfall follows a linear sequence — define, design, build, test, deliver — where each phase completes before the next begins. Best for: construction projects, events, regulatory compliance programmes, and any work with fixed scope and contractual deliverables. Best tool for Waterfall: Asana (Gantt timeline view, task dependencies, milestone tracking). Secondary: Monday.com Gantt view.
| Metric | What It Measures |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| On-time delivery rate | % of tasks and milestones completed on schedule | Primary indicator of project management effectiveness |
| Budget variance | Actual cost vs planned cost | Early warning of scope creep and resource inefficiency |
| Team capacity utilisation | % of available time used on project work | Identifies over/under-allocation before it causes burnout or delays |
| Cycle time | Time from task creation to completion | Reveals bottlenecks in your workflow process |
| Client satisfaction (NPS) | Net Promoter Score from project stakeholders | Lagging indicator of project delivery quality |

Project management software is most powerful when it connects to the other tools your team uses daily. Here are the integrations that deliver the most operational value:
| Integration | Benefit | Best PM Tool for This |
|---|---|---|
| Slack / Microsoft Teams | Receive task notifications in chat channels; create tasks from messages | All major tools — Monday, Asana, ClickUp, Trello |
| Google Drive / Dropbox | Attach files directly to tasks from cloud storage without downloading | All tools — deep native integration |
| GitHub / GitLab | Link code commits and pull requests to project tasks automatically | ClickUp, Asana, Jira |
| CRM (HubSpot, Salesforce) | Convert won deals into project boards without manual data re-entry | Monday CRM, ClickUp, Asana |
| Accounting (QuickBooks, Xero) | Track project costs against budget and generate project profitability reports | ClickUp, Monday.com |
| Time tracking (Harvest, Clockify) | Log billable hours against tasks for accurate client invoicing | All major PM tools via native or Zapier |

To illustrate how different PM tools serve different business types, here are three scenarios from common ClipsTrust business categories:
Business: A digital marketing agency with 8 staff managing 15 concurrent client accounts, each requiring weekly deliverables.
Best tool: Monday.com — clients are added as CRM deals, won clients flip to project boards, weekly deliverables are tracked as recurring tasks, and a client dashboard shows all active campaigns at a glance. The visual board makes client status immediately clear in account review meetings.
Business: An IT company with 12 developers working in 2-week sprints across 3 concurrent software projects.
Best tool: ClickUp — sprint management, GitHub integration for pull request tracking, sprint velocity reporting, and bug tracking in one tool. The free plan covers all needs until the team exceeds 100MB storage.
Business: An event management company planning 8–12 events simultaneously, each with 50–100 tasks, vendor coordination, and strict deadlines.
Best tool: Asana — each event is a project with a Gantt timeline view showing all tasks against the event date. Dependencies ensure venue booking must be confirmed before catering can be contracted. Portfolio view shows all events and their completion percentage simultaneously.
